Hello Doctor, for the past three days, I have been experiencing nausea (especially when standing), numbness throughout my body, a constant cold feeling in my feet, excessive sleepiness (I sleep around 18 hours a day), a dry throat, and loss of appetite due to food tasting different. On the first day of these symptoms, I visited a doctor who gave me an injection and advised me to get a blood test, which I have attached here. He also mentioned that my blood pressure has been consistently low, around 70, for two consecutive days. I am feeling very uneasy and worried.

These symptoms can suggest dehydration, low sugar or vitamin deficiency. A basic health panel including electrolytes, blood sugar, and vitamin B12 would be useful to guide further treatment.
